How can i put my output numbers in for loop to an array

z=('/Users/fatihnurcin/Desktop/Dandnd/dilated')
cd(z)
list = dir('*.bmp');
for i = 1:length(list)
img{i} = imread(list(i).name);
end
for i = 1:length(list)
a=img{i};
b=im2bw(a,0.20);
figure
subplot(1,3,1);
imshow(b)
c=b(120,100:250);
subplot(1,3,3);
plot(c);
for n=1:length(c);
d= padarray(c,[0 1],'replicate','post');
e(n)=d(n)-d(n+1);
left=find(e==1);
right=find(e==-1);
f=right-left;
end
f
end
This is my whole code, it takes a row from a binary photo and tries to find where its black and where its not and calculate the black area so i want to ask how can i put my outputs(outputs are numbers calculated due to black arena) in an array, i couldn't do it by adding (n) to left and right,
left(n)=find(e(n)==1);
right(n)=find(e(n)==-1);
f(n)=right(n)-left(n);

Honestly, it is clear to me you don't really know what you are doing with MATLAB. After this project is done, you need to read up "getting started" documents for MATLAB. The code below is ugly but works. I believe it is what you want as well.
list = dir('*.bmp');
% preallocate cell array
img = cell(length(list),1);
f = cell(length(list), 250-100);
for i = 1:length(list)
img{i} = imread(list(i).name);
end
for i = 1:length(list)
a=img{i};
b=im2bw(a,0.20);
figure;
subplot(1,3,1);
imshow(b)
c=b(120,100:250);
subplot(1,3,3);
plot(c);
for n=1:length(c);
d= padarray(c,[0 1],'replicate','post');
e(n)=d(n)-d(n+1);
left=find(e==1);
right=find(e==-1);
f{i, n} = right-left;
end
end
